, `SERVER\INSTANCE`) or using an wrong port number—will prevent the client from locating the listening socket. If using Always On Availability Groups, the application must direct traffic to the current primary replica, often requiring MultiSubnetFailover=True in the string to speed up the detection process.
Understanding and Reducing SQL Server Connection Timeout Issues
Balancing these settings based on the application’s concurrency and workload is crucial for maintaining performance without sacrificing reliability. Confusing these two values is a common mistake; setting a command timeout to thirty seconds does nothing to fix a network path that is unreachable.
A misspelled keyword, such as `ConnectT Timeout` instead of `Connect Timeout`, or an incorrect server address will immediately break the link. Decoding the Timeout Parameters To resolve a connection timeout, one must first distinguish between the two primary timeout settings embedded in the connection string.
Optimize Connection String to Reduce SQL Server Connection Timeout Issues
Network Layer Obstacles A connection timeout often indicates a failure at the network layer rather than an issue with SQL Server itself. Additionally, the Windows service account running SQL Server must have the necessary permissions, and the server’s local firewall must allow inbound traffic on the designated port.
More About Connection timeout sql server connection string
Looking at Connection timeout sql server connection string from another angle can help expand the discussion and give readers a second clear paragraph under the same section.
More perspective on Connection timeout sql server connection string can make the topic easier to follow by connecting earlier points with a few simple takeaways.